    U.S. Coast Guard Cmdr. Brian Gismervik, commanding officer of Coast Guard Cutter Northland (WMEC 904), U.S. Navy Cmdr. Jeremiah Chase, commanding officer of Arleigh Burke-class guided-missile destroyer USS Delbert D. Black (DDG 119) and Royal Canadian navy Capt. Gord Noseworthy, commander of Task Group 300.10, talk at a pre-sail conference for Operation Nanook, Aug. 12, 2024, in Halifax, Nova Scotia. Operation Nanook is an international exercise led by Canada to increase mission readiness in the Arctic. (U.S. Coast Guard photo by Petty Officer 3rd Class Anthony Randisi)
